The Request for Quote (RFQ) system stands as a foundational tool, transforming how participants interact with available liquidity.

An RFQ system enables a trader to solicit bids and offers from multiple liquidity providers simultaneously. This process cultivates competitive pricing for options contracts, especially for larger sizes or complex multi-leg strategies. Unlike passively placing orders into an order book, an RFQ actively aggregates interest, providing a consolidated view of executable prices. This method significantly mitigates adverse selection, ensuring a participant transacts at a price reflecting the true market consensus for a specific instrument.

The result is a substantial improvement in execution quality, directly influencing the profitability of options positions. My professional experience confirms that neglecting this fundamental mechanism means leaving considerable value on the table.

Understanding market microstructure remains central to effective RFQ deployment. Crypto markets, characterized by their high volatility and occasional fragmentation, benefit immensely from the structured liquidity access an RFQ provides. Measures such as the Roll measure or Kyle’s lambda, traditionally applied to evaluate illiquidity and information asymmetry, reveal the inherent challenges of these markets.

RFQ systems address these challenges by creating a controlled environment for price formation, reducing the implicit costs associated with trading. This active engagement with liquidity providers represents a strategic shift from merely reacting to market prices to commanding them.

Block Trading Precision

Large options positions, often termed block trades, historically faced considerable market impact and slippage when executed through standard order books. An RFQ system specifically addresses this challenge, facilitating the discreet and efficient execution of substantial orders. By channeling requests to multiple institutional liquidity providers, the system enables participants to secure optimal pricing for significant volumes without signaling their intent to the broader market. This anonymous negotiation minimizes price distortion, preserving the integrity of the intended trade.

The result ▴ reduced transaction costs and superior fill rates for substantial allocations. The process empowers traders to move size with confidence, ensuring their capital deployment aligns precisely with their strategic objectives.

Multi-Leg Options Efficiency

Executing multi-leg options strategies, such as straddles, collars, or butterflies, demands synchronous execution of multiple components at favorable prices. RFQ systems excel in this domain by allowing traders to request quotes for an entire spread as a single unit. This unified approach eliminates the individual leg risk inherent in sequential order book execution, where one leg might fill at an unfavorable price before the others. The aggregated quote ensures the desired spread relationship is maintained, guaranteeing the intended risk-reward profile of the strategy.

This precision simplifies complex hedging and speculative plays, providing a clear advantage in managing volatility exposures. Traders gain the capacity to implement intricate strategies with a single, consolidated price point, streamlining their operational workflow.

Volatility Plays and Edge Capture

Crypto options markets frequently exhibit pronounced volatility dynamics, often characterized by heavy tails and significant price jumps. RFQ systems assist in capitalizing on these dynamics by providing a real-time snapshot of implied volatility across various strikes and maturities. When structuring volatility plays, such as long or short gamma strategies, access to competitive, executable quotes becomes paramount. The ability to compare implied volatilities from multiple sources via RFQ allows for identifying mispricings or capturing a favorable entry point.

This direct access to liquidity providers fosters a dynamic environment for expressing directional or non-directional volatility views. The outcome translates into an optimized cost basis for positions designed to profit from anticipated market movements. Dynamic Hedging Optimization

Advanced options strategies frequently involve dynamic hedging, requiring precise adjustments to underlying exposures. The rapid execution and competitive pricing offered by RFQ systems become indispensable in this context. Rebalancing delta, gamma, or vega exposures for substantial options portfolios necessitates transacting efficiently in both the options and spot markets. Utilizing RFQ for options adjustments ensures these hedges are placed at optimal levels, preserving the efficacy of the overall risk mitigation strategy.

This operational agility directly contributes to a portfolio’s resilience against adverse market shifts. Considering the intrinsic volatility of crypto assets, the capacity for swift, precise hedging holds profound implications for capital preservation.

Quantitative Edge Enhancement

The data generated from RFQ interactions offers a rich source for refining quantitative models and identifying market inefficiencies. Observing how different liquidity providers quote various options structures under varying market conditions provides actionable insights. This empirical feedback loop allows for the continuous calibration of pricing models, such as the Kou or Bates models, which incorporate jumps and stochastic volatility for improved accuracy.

A diligent strategist leverages this granular execution data to enhance predictive capabilities and refine entry/exit signals. The iterative process of execution, data collection, and model refinement establishes a virtuous cycle, deepening the quantitative edge within a competitive landscape.

Execution Quality

Meaning ▴ Execution Quality quantifies the efficacy of an order's fill, assessing how closely the achieved trade price aligns with the prevailing market price at submission, alongside consideration for speed, cost, and market impact.

Market Microstructure

Meaning ▴ Market Microstructure refers to the study of the processes and rules by which securities are traded, focusing on the specific mechanisms of price discovery, order flow dynamics, and transaction costs within a trading venue.
